Design and Build Quality

The MV7 borrows its DNA from the SM7B — the microphone heard on countless podcasts and radio broadcasts. The all-metal housing feels indestructible and looks professional on camera. The integrated yoke mount attaches to any standard 5/8-inch boom arm or sits on a desk with the included adapter. The touch panel on the back controls gain, headphone volume, and monitoring mix. USB-C and XLR outputs live on the bottom, allowing simultaneous connection to a computer and audio interface. Beyond the aesthetics, the build quality tells a story of thoughtful engineering. Audio quality is excellent for a USB microphone. The dynamic capsule naturally rejects room noise, keyboard clicks, and background sounds — a massive advantage over condenser alternatives. Voice reproduction is warm, full, and broadcast-ready with minimal processing needed. The Auto Level mode is remarkable for beginners, automatically adjusting gain as you move closer or farther from the mic. Through XLR with a quality preamp, the MV7 approaches SM7B quality at half the price.

Is the Shure MV7 USB/XLR Microphone Worth the Price?

At $299, the MV7 is priced above the Blue Yeti ($129) and Elgato Wave:3 ($149) but the dual USB/XLR capability and Shure’s legendary audio quality justify the premium. The SM7B costs $399 and requires a separate audio interface ($100+). The MV7 delivers 80% of the SM7B’s quality with the convenience of USB plug-and-play. For serious content creators, this is the microphone to buy.
